Southwest Schools Bissonnet El Campus is located at 8440 BISSONNET ST, HOUSTON, TX, 77074. The school is part of SOUTHWEST SCHOOL.

To contact the school, call (713) 988-5839.
Teachers
Southwest Schools Bissonnet El Campus employs 24 teachers, who have been with the school an average of 2 years. The teachers average 8 years of experience in teaching. The school currently has 437 students with a student to teacher ratio of 18.50 S/T.

Choosing the best possible elementary school is critical to a child's foundational development. In Texas, charter school districts adopt curriculum standards set by the State Board of Education. The current standards, called Texas Essential Knowledge and Skills, outline what students should be able to learn and do in each course or grade. The curriculum is structured around the fundamentals of mathematics, science, social studies, language arts, music and reading.
